Когда я создаю новый командный проект в TFS 2010? - PullRequest
4 голосов
/ 26 октября 2011

Мы настраиваем TFS 2010, и у нас есть около 15 различных приложений, которые мы хотели бы перенести в TFS. Мы уже решили, что будем делать 1 коллекцию. У меня вопрос: должны ли мы создавать несколько командных проектов для каждого из наших приложений или мы должны поместить все наши приложения в один командный проект? С какими преимуществами / недостатками мы столкнемся с этими сценариями для рабочих элементов, сборок и т. Д.

Ответы [ 2 ]

6 голосов
/ 26 октября 2011

Моя точка зрения на то, что должно быть в командном проекте, состоит в том, имеют ли приложения и / или люди, работающие над приложениями, общие ресурсы, например, рабочие элементы.

В предстоящем TFS11 есть понятие невыполненных заданий(если вы еще не видели, я рекомендую перейти на \ BUILD \ records ).Если ваши приложения совместно используют спринты или журналы, то я бы создал один командный проект (или групповой проект на пул приложений, которые их разделяют).

Если приложения разрабатываются отдельно и вы хотите использовать разные процессы,затем используйте несколько командных проектов.

0 голосов
/ 27 октября 2011

Недавно я увидел хороший пост одного из рейнджеров TFS ALM, в котором рассматриваются все основные недостатки разделения на несколько командных проектов.

http://msmvps.com/blogs/vstsblog/archive/2010/11/12/good-reasons-to-not-create-a-new-team-project.aspx

Однако, как отмечает Эвальд, новый Sprint, поддержка Backlog и Team в TFS11 на самом деле являются достаточно вескими причинами для разделения ваших проектов.

...